Ok Program INC
The ok program is a national mentoring model for african american men and boys. the program brings together police and pastors around the country to recruit, train and organize african american men to mentor african american boys 12-18 years old. the primary goal of the program is to help our young men develop leadership and critical thinking skills, promote academic excellence and reduce the high rates of incarceration and homicide of young african american males.
